The constraints of a problem are listed below. What are the vertices of the feasible region?
Grace [21]
The vertices are the intersections between the lines.

1) line x + y = 5 and y = 3:

y = 3 => x + 3 = 5 => x = 5 - 3 => x = 2

=> vertix = (2,3)

2) line x + y = 5 and y = 0

=> y = 0 => x + 0 = 5 => x = 5

=> vertix = (5,0)

3) line x + y = 5 and x = 0

=> 0 + y = 5 => y = 5

=>  (0,5) ------> this is not a vertix because it is above the line y = 3

4) line y = 3 and x-axis

=> vertix = (0,3)

5) x-axis and y-axis => origin => vertix = (0,0)

So, there are four vertices: (0,0), (5,0), (2,3) and (0,3)

Answer: That is the first option:(<span>0, 0), (0, 3), (2, 3), (5, 0)</span>
